It is years since we had any, and yet the memory of this golden dish makes our mouth water. "Injun menl." ue called it bnrk home, h was made into a sort of pudding the night before and put away to "set." Then in the morning Mom carved it into strips about a quarter of an inrh thick maybe closer to a half and fried it on the kitchen stove. We can still hear it sputtering and see it in nil its golden glow as ue poured maple besirup on it and went to town.
